EDIT: looks like they went up a little at Autohauz. As you posted above, 68.40 each. They were about $55 a couple of months ago.
For the most part they pop off and pop back on.
Some units have a couple of the plastic tabs melted to the main housing. No big deal to break it loose. I have used a dremel to slice it loose in the past but most times you can just snap them loose with a screwdriver.
DIY here: http://www.pcarworkshop.com/index.ph...ing_Headlights
You will be amazed at the difference it makes to the overall appearance of the front end.
